90-12-09 AIRSHIP INDUSTRIES: Amendment 39-6623. Docket No. 90-CE-09-AD.
Applicability: Model Skyship 600 Series (all serial numbers) airships certificated in any category.
Compliance: Required within the next 100 hours time-in-service after the effective date of this AD, unless already accomplished.
To preclude loss of lift capability, accomplish the following:
(a) Inspect the attachment of the gaiter to the T-chest, and if double sided tape has been used, prior to further flight install a bonded reinforcement repair in accordance with the instructions specified in Airship Industries Alert Service Bulletin SB Ref 600-53-A311, dated June 10, 1989.
(b) Airships may be flown in accordance with FAR 21.197 to a location where this AD can be accomplished.
(c) An alternate method of compliance or adjustment of the compliance time which provides an equivalent level of safety, may be approved by the Manager, Brussels Aircraft Certification Office, c/o American Embassy, APO New York 09667-1011.
